Selective Repeat ARQ

Поділитися
Вставка
  • Опубліковано 8 лис 2024

КОМЕНТАРІ • 120

  • @theSisBroChannel
    @theSisBroChannel 4 роки тому +577

    I slept through the entire semester on this subject because I find it boring but you made it interesting, thank you!

    • @morgard211
      @morgard211 4 роки тому +20

      networks are boring af :/ gladly I won't have to hear about them if I succeed in the exam

    • @user-mi8ew2to8e
      @user-mi8ew2to8e 4 роки тому +14

      @@morgard211 I don't know what you are talking about.
      I started studying from Neso Academy and find it really interesting. Always wondered, how these communications happen.

    • @morgard211
      @morgard211 4 роки тому +14

      @@user-mi8ew2to8e well it's very subjective

    • @shareenapk19
      @shareenapk19 2 роки тому +1

      @Shreevatsa Bhat what about mss, I didn't remember a single from that subject.

    • @AvikNayak_
      @AvikNayak_ 2 роки тому +6

      @Shreevatsa Bhat No that would be software engineering,compiler design,microprocessors and microcontrollers.

  • @bhavya2301
    @bhavya2301 4 роки тому +26

    Our Community Is Better Because You Are In It.Thanks For The Videos😌

  • @novicecoder5753
    @novicecoder5753 3 роки тому +22

    The best instructor in neso academy I have seen in this computer networks playlist thanks for this content 🙏🙏🙏🙏

  • @aayushpandey228
    @aayushpandey228 Рік тому +19

    Watched your all videos which are based on protocols. Now, I am crystal clear what actually protocol is 💯

  • @SanthoshaK-w5b
    @SanthoshaK-w5b 8 місяців тому +5

    the presentation you are doing. it took lot off time to prepare. such a hard you are doing for free course. thank you so much for making these video. it helps me a lot

  • @niki9676
    @niki9676 6 днів тому

    I'm very thankful for your videos. I know I can seem crazy but content like yours are heritage of humanity.

  • @Shivamkumar-ge4yo
    @Shivamkumar-ge4yo 2 роки тому +1

    Today is my exam and I thought that stop and wait protocol is so boring and tough to understand and prayed to god that please don't ask questions about this topic in my exam but after watching your video now I changed my mind and pray to god that please ask at least one question in my exam of 5 or 10 marks.
    Thank you so much.

  • @SanthoshaK-w5b
    @SanthoshaK-w5b 8 місяців тому +1

    The presentation your are doing takes a lot off time to you. thank you so much for providing free content like this.

  • @livinlife2119
    @livinlife2119 3 роки тому +8

    I felt this subject interesting after watching your videos.. thankyou so much

  • @YunusInamdar-u8x
    @YunusInamdar-u8x Рік тому +1

    thnx mann your video helped me covering syllabus just a night before my exams

  • @yaiphare0076
    @yaiphare0076 4 роки тому +7

    Please upload more videos on computer networks, want to study more on computer networks during lockdown period.

  • @Teklay-d9u
    @Teklay-d9u 25 днів тому +1

    I appreciated you .becaouse Your lectures are very amazing

  • @luebbelicious437
    @luebbelicious437 29 днів тому +2

    thank you for my help, tutor. i used it.

  • @subhadipnandi1951
    @subhadipnandi1951 4 роки тому +18

    sir carry on , i told my friends to watch yours videos..pls upload more videos on this subject

  • @lokeshpotluri2068
    @lokeshpotluri2068 2 роки тому +2

    Best video in order to prepare at the time of semester

  • @LavanVivekanandasarma
    @LavanVivekanandasarma 2 роки тому +13

    A great and super concise explanation! Thanks!

  • @Asim_Usama
    @Asim_Usama 2 роки тому +19

    JazakAllah for this easy and wonderful lecture on this topic.
    May Allah gives you more knowledge.

  • @shutdahellup69420
    @shutdahellup69420 Рік тому +15

    4:18 *CORRECTION:* The sliding window does have significance. The erroneous bit is sent AFTER the sender window is empty. It sends the erroneous bit and continues where it left off. Meanwhile the receiver sends NACK of the erroneous bit with every ACK of subsequent bits.

    • @tusharmahajan-ng2ch
      @tusharmahajan-ng2ch 10 місяців тому +1

      Would you make it more clear i didn't get you?

    • @Lexyvil
      @Lexyvil 25 днів тому

      Same, would love some clarity.

  • @aishwaryakudatarkar3891
    @aishwaryakudatarkar3891 3 роки тому +23

    I thought that subject is boring. But no... The fault is not in the subject, but it's in the professor.
    Thanks for ur effort, so that we can effortlessly write our exams.🙏🙏

    • @oggy107
      @oggy107 3 роки тому +3

      actually the fault isn't in subject nor in teacher but in ourselves. if one has interest in any subject, he/she will put efforts to gain knowledge even without a teacher.

    • @nomen385
      @nomen385 3 роки тому +6

      @@oggy107 nah bro. It's the teacher's fault💀. You can't force desire on boring lectures

    • @oggy107
      @oggy107 3 роки тому +1

      @@nomen385 i literally said you don't need a teacher if you are interested in any subject.

    • @nomen385
      @nomen385 3 роки тому +1

      @@oggy107 ahnok. I get you now👍🏾

    • @observantmagic4156
      @observantmagic4156 2 роки тому

      @@oggy107 yes but the prof should make the subject interesting while introducing it. A student cannot be interested if the prof can’t explain exactly what’s going on. Something which neso academy does very well.

  • @joaopedroalves6777
    @joaopedroalves6777 5 місяців тому +3

    Thank god for indian IT youtube

  • @tsonga12
    @tsonga12 4 роки тому +34

    How does the sliding window slide when frame 2 is not acknowledged? and Why the sender won't send a new packet when frame 3 is acknowledged but wait for frame 4 to be acknowledged to send frame 6? Thank you.

    • @kavinesh2321
      @kavinesh2321 2 роки тому +1

      Dude, but it has sent for 3, and not for 2. So, as per the sequence num, it sends nack for 2, and the others are normal

  • @varunak1786
    @varunak1786 2 роки тому +1

    Thanks a lot yaar❤.It helps a lot for my semester preparation.

  • @hellymodi856
    @hellymodi856 2 роки тому +2

    my professor is teaching us CN from your videos and make it look like they made that video
    but anyways your videos are great

  • @erukullaharshavardhan6198
    @erukullaharshavardhan6198 3 роки тому +3

    Nice explaination bro

  • @A1Tech6111
    @A1Tech6111 7 місяців тому

    Thank you sir understand extremely with your leature

  • @vinayaksharma-ys3ip
    @vinayaksharma-ys3ip 2 роки тому +1

    Thnak You very much Sir!!

  • @Daniel-iy1ed
    @Daniel-iy1ed Рік тому +1

    Lovely and complete 💯 thank you so much 😌💗

  • @prks.sudhan8377
    @prks.sudhan8377 Рік тому

    Mast kaam kr rhe hai aap maja agya❤✌

  • @souravprasaddas5909
    @souravprasaddas5909 4 роки тому +3

    Please upload data structures videos

  • @dhruvamin197
    @dhruvamin197 4 роки тому +10

    If frame 2 is lost, then receiver window should wait for frame 2, and then when timeout occurs on sender side, it will send frame 2 and then on receiving frame 2 on receiver side, receiver will acknowledge and will slide the window by 4 because 3,4,5 are already stored. On sender side on receiving acknowledge of 2, it will slide the window by 4. Is this correct?

    • @amaanmohammad1190
      @amaanmohammad1190 3 роки тому +4

      If frame 2 is lost and frame 3,4,5 are received, the receiver window is not moved forward. The reciveer will simply put 3,4,5 in the buffer. When it receives frame 2 , it groups and delivers 2,3,4,5 and moves the window forward by 4 frames ( because a total of 4 frames were delivered).

    • @amaanmohammad1190
      @amaanmohammad1190 3 роки тому +1

      You are correct.

  • @yashasvi2602
    @yashasvi2602 Рік тому

    such good explanation.

  • @ssadik7038
    @ssadik7038 3 роки тому +2

    Tomorrow my exam tq bro

  • @mohanganesh8811
    @mohanganesh8811 3 роки тому +2

    Wonderful Tq

  • @eliy5550
    @eliy5550 2 роки тому

    ABSOLUTE LEGEND!

  • @asrithperuri629
    @asrithperuri629 4 роки тому +1

    Very nice explained good concept in less time 👍👌

  • @saptarshichattopadhyay8234
    @saptarshichattopadhyay8234 5 місяців тому

    Thank you so much 💓 💗 💛 💖 ☺️ 😊

  • @chesskeda7948
    @chesskeda7948 8 місяців тому +2

    i got back in this sub hope these lec helps in clearing my back

    • @ChefBouny
      @ChefBouny 7 місяців тому

      Shame on you 😔

    • @harrygamer6209
      @harrygamer6209 7 місяців тому +1

      Why shame man its a part of life idiot..

  • @ayleanexe
    @ayleanexe Рік тому +1

    i love this account. thank you so much for the great videos and excellent explanations ! :)

  • @ProgrammingNusantara
    @ProgrammingNusantara 3 роки тому +2

    Thank u sir. Good content and presentation 👍

  • @dhanajipatil228
    @dhanajipatil228 5 місяців тому

    Thankyou

  • @preeyankasamim6933
    @preeyankasamim6933 2 роки тому

    Best explanation, thank you

  • @mdasifuddin2062
    @mdasifuddin2062 2 роки тому +1

    Can't thank enough!

  • @aishwaryamb1070
    @aishwaryamb1070 2 роки тому

    Ur teaching is amazing sir, thq

  • @ZETAZOOM
    @ZETAZOOM 3 роки тому +3

    Really impressive teaching 👌

  • @siasecurityprogramming7007
    @siasecurityprogramming7007 Рік тому

    thank you

  • @aryank1
    @aryank1 Рік тому

    thank you very much

  • @mrnikkyaofficial..3350
    @mrnikkyaofficial..3350 Рік тому

    Thank uhh sir ❤️

  • @udaysaipillalamarri2269
    @udaysaipillalamarri2269 4 роки тому +3

    Hello sir!!....
    please upload and continue the videos on power systems.
    This is my sincere request.

  • @rumanzahid6671
    @rumanzahid6671 4 роки тому +1

    Great channel

  • @shreyashchoudhary2637
    @shreyashchoudhary2637 3 роки тому

    Easy to understand!

  • @neetuvanshkar8291
    @neetuvanshkar8291 2 роки тому

    Thanks sir😊😊

  • @spidymistry8150
    @spidymistry8150 11 місяців тому +2

    Would sender send 6 first before getting aknowledge of 2(2nd time)?

  • @jitulborah_10
    @jitulborah_10 Рік тому

    thank you 😇 watching it 10 min before exam😅

  • @rengarajansrinivasan4356
    @rengarajansrinivasan4356 Рік тому

    Thanks a lot!!

  • @clementinerose916
    @clementinerose916 4 роки тому +1

    Good video. so helpful , thank youu

  • @its_me_hb
    @its_me_hb 3 роки тому

    God for engineering students❤❤

  • @clintonskywalker920
    @clintonskywalker920 2 роки тому

    you are awesome

  • @tharuntharun1976
    @tharuntharun1976 7 місяців тому

    Tq 🎉❤❤❤❤

  • @geshbenrewand1778
    @geshbenrewand1778 4 роки тому

    God bless you

  • @MarcioLima-oi5bf
    @MarcioLima-oi5bf 3 роки тому +1

    nice vídeo

  • @ahmadsan2907
    @ahmadsan2907 Рік тому

    lifesaver

  • @nexesdz3907
    @nexesdz3907 3 роки тому

    Thanks alot.It was helpful

  • @Lexyvil
    @Lexyvil 25 днів тому

    So from my understanding at 4:10, frames outside the window (like frame 6) can still be sent? Even if the window is waiting for frame 2's acknowledgement to proceed?

  • @antoniopedrodias5991
    @antoniopedrodias5991 3 роки тому

    excelent work!!!!!

  • @cipher984
    @cipher984 4 роки тому +14

    I need 4x speed for your videos!

  • @SLAnimalLovers98718
    @SLAnimalLovers98718 11 місяців тому

    A great and super

  • @MM.MischiefManaged
    @MM.MischiefManaged Рік тому +1

    Why didnt you slide the window at all? I thought it would after 5 was ack and frame 7 was sent?

  • @shubhamthanki1896
    @shubhamthanki1896 Рік тому

    What is the concept about negative acknowledgement ? Imagine if the acknowledgement is lost, then does the sender assumes it by default as negative acknowledgement ?

  • @03_abhishekchoubey42
    @03_abhishekchoubey42 3 роки тому +3

    Sir what is the window size in selective repeat

    • @jolly_dollyyy
      @jolly_dollyyy 3 роки тому +1

      As said in video,there is no significance of window size and only corrupted packet is retransmitted

  • @GauravKumar-15
    @GauravKumar-15 Рік тому +2

    This is last night before exam and stil half of syllabus is remaining 🥲

  • @arindamdutta7369
    @arindamdutta7369 11 місяців тому

    crystal cleaer GBN And Selective repeat

  • @gauravpawar2637
    @gauravpawar2637 3 роки тому +1

    where i can find all these PPT's or the notes for the same

  • @oscarwong5226
    @oscarwong5226 2 роки тому

    Is Selective Repeat better than Go-Back-N in time performance?

  • @roselynsaki
    @roselynsaki 3 роки тому

    god bless✨ istg

  • @iqbalahmad8222
    @iqbalahmad8222 Рік тому

    Assume that two computers A and B are connected with 512 Gbps
    bandwidth. Consider if the distance between the hosts is M metres and the
    link speed of the medium is 2 x 109 m/s. If Computer A need to send a one-
    kilobyte packet to Computer B. What is the minimum distance M required
    such that the propagation delay equals the transmission delay?

  • @celestinechasama4764
    @celestinechasama4764 4 роки тому +1

    wow so interesting

  • @error-my9ut
    @error-my9ut Рік тому

    sliding window is required here bcoz how would one achieve flow control without that, the main objective of this whole thing was flow control

  • @yashvanthyashu8802
    @yashvanthyashu8802 10 місяців тому

    ❤❤❤

  • @jroseme
    @jroseme Рік тому

    Do you know why the hell is my homework asking for the difference in window size between Selective Repeat and Go back N given the same number of bits for sequence number? I don't see why there would be any difference in the window size between the two.

  • @emilynieto6498
    @emilynieto6498 Рік тому

    is selective repeat arq the same as selective repeat protocol?

  • @jannatulferdos7063
    @jannatulferdos7063 13 днів тому

    Sequence of packet is not maintained then how would it be efficient,?

  • @manjumv5218
    @manjumv5218 2 роки тому

    i have a doubt, the sender window size and receiver window size is half of the sequence number. so it is 2 . plz clarify this

    • @manjumv5218
      @manjumv5218 2 роки тому

      in the case of selective repeat.

  • @dharini2475
    @dharini2475 3 роки тому

    8/7/21
    4:45 pm

  • @saivignesh6611
    @saivignesh6611 2 роки тому

    5:18 pm
    Tuesday, 24 May 2022 (IST)
    Time in Kattankulathur, Tamil Nadu#ccnsem

  • @gamesinfo1005
    @gamesinfo1005 2 роки тому

    Hi , can someone tell me how the receiver answer by ACK4 before the receiving of frame4 ?!

  • @deepajose7516
    @deepajose7516 Рік тому

    One doubt..here pack 2 is not acknowledged.

  • @soumilyade1057
    @soumilyade1057 2 роки тому +2

    Why doesn't the sender wait for the acknowledgement for the retransmitted packet..?

  • @rithanyabalamurali6936
    @rithanyabalamurali6936 2 роки тому

    but it is not in sequence so will it discard the other frames?

  • @abdullahmohammad5613
    @abdullahmohammad5613 3 роки тому +2

    You went to fast on the topic!

  • @saitejareddy9425
    @saitejareddy9425 2 роки тому +1

  • @Arpitkandari-w3i
    @Arpitkandari-w3i 5 місяців тому

    Your voice is really 😂😂😂😂